The Injective Staking Exchange-Traded Product (AINJ), recently introduced by 21Shares, enables users to stake their INJ to receive staking incentives while gaining exposure to INJ on some of the biggest traditional finance exchange venues and brokerages.

21Shares AINJ ETP’s Launch

With a number of years of experience in the field, 21Shares has collaborated with top cryptocurrency projects and has been a pillar in the closely watched endeavor to introduce the first Bitcoin ETF alongside Cathie Wood’s Ark Invest. The fact that 21Shares has over $3 billion in assets under management for this offering attests to its caliber and dependability.

An important step toward institutional adoption is the launch of AINJ. It creates new opportunities for high-ranking players in Injective and has transparent offerings and enforceable regulations.

A few of the top traditional finance exchanges and brokerages, like Interactive Brokers, Saxo Bank, Swissquote, and eToro, are beginning to embrace the regulated and transparent product, which makes institutional involvement quite simple.

The Innovation and Significance of AINJ ETP

Since there aren’t many cryptocurrency assets linked to ETPs worldwide, AINJ’s launch highlights the innovation and significance of this concept. It now becomes a component of a select group of products that give institutional and private users access to the world of digital assets.

The release states that the AINJ ETP is kept in cold storage by an institutional-grade custodian and is fully supported by the underlying INJ. Direct exposure to the asset is made possible by this arrangement, which lowers operating expenses.
